(ET) The hydrocarbon-onshore division of L&T’s energy business has secured a large contract from Indian Oil Corporation . L&T defines large contracts between the range of Rs 2500 crore and Rs 5000 crore. IOCL is implementing the Panipat refinery expansion (P-25) project to enhance refining capacity from 15 MMTPA to 25 MMTPA (million metric tonnes per annum) to meet the growth in demand of petroleum products and to increase their profitability and competitiveness in the long run. The engineering, procurement, construction, and commissioning (EPCC) contract is for setting up a Residue Hydrocracker Unit (RHCU) for this P-25 Project.

(ET) State-owned power giant NTPC  said it has started capturing carbon dioxide (CO2) from the flue gas stream at its thermal plant in Vindhyachal. “As part of its commitment towards Net Zero by 2070, NTPC Ltd India’s largest integrated power company has captured its first CO2 on 15th August 2022 from flue gas stream of 500 MW coal based power plant (Unit-13) at Vindhyachal Super Thermal Power Station (VSTPS),” a company statement said. According to the statement, this plant is designed to capture 20 tonnes of CO2 every day. This initiative will pave the way for scaling up CO2 capture technology and greening the…

(ET) India on Saturday recorded 13,272 new coronavirus infections, bringing the total to 4,43,27,890, while the number of active cases decreased to 1,01,166, the Union health ministry data revealed. The death toll from COVID-19 rose to 5,27,289 with 36 fatalities, including six deaths that Kerala reconciled, the data updated at 8 am showed. The active cases comprise 0.23 per cent of the total infections, while the national COVID-19 recovery rate stands at 98.58 per cent, the ministry said.

(MC) Oil prices steadied on Friday, but fell for the week on a stronger U.S. dollar and fears that an economic slowdown would weaken crude demand. Brent crude futures settled at $96.72 a barrel, gaining 13 cents. U.S. West Texas Intermediate crude ended 27 cents higher at $90.77. Both benchmarks fell about 1.5 per cent on the week. Oil briefly jumped in volatile trade on comments made by Richmond Federal Reserve President Thomas Barkin that the Fed would balance its rate hike path with uncertainty over any impact on the economy. (FE) Adani Power, the country’s largest thermal power generator, will fully acquire DB Power for an enterprise value of ₹7,017 crore. DB Power, a Bhaskar Group-promoted company, owns and operates two thermal power plants with a capacity of 600 MW each in Chhattisgarh. With this deal, Adani Power’s installed thermal power capacity would go up to 14,810 MW, from 13,610 MW at present. A further 1,600 MW capacity is under-construction.
